From Assago to Valverde by bus, metro and train
To get from Assago to Valverde in Milan and Lombardy, you’ll need to take one metro line, one train line and one bus line: take the M2 metro from Assago Milanofiori Nord station to Lambrate FS station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the R34 train and finally take the 85 bus from Stradella - Vittorio Veneto station to Zavattarello - Moline - Sp412r station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 5 hr 41 min. The bus, metro and train schedule from Assago may change.
